This hostel is very typical of Hungary. Decoration is made with recycled objects. You will see if you come there. There is a garden where you can chill out and have your breakfast for instance which is very pleasant when the weather is warm.

At first saw the hostel might scare you a bit, everything seems a mess! After talking with the owner and realize how easy going he is the first impression go away and you feel very comfortable. It is a family hostel is a 10 minute walk from the old town, where you feel very welcome. I'll return, for sure! :)

Pleasant, welcoming, clean and situated a mere 5-minute walk from downtown Pécs. The staff were more than happy to make suggestions, and the set-up of the hostel gives it a warm, homey feeling. If I were to visit the city again, I'd definitely stay there.
